Building a thriving homestead at the Howling Hill Greymane Camp is one of the most rewarding side activities in Crimson Desert. While the game initially suggests you can 'manually' bring animals back to your ranch, after you've done the Goat required for the tutorial, you probably won't want to build out a ranch that way. Thankfully, there is an easier way.
The secret to a full ranch isn't found by carrying animals on your back. It’s found in the relationships you build. By maxing out Trust with specific NPCs, you can unlock the ability to purchase livestock directly from Ben at your home base. In fact, it's the same system used to get your first pet.
All Ranch Animals In Crimson Desert & How To Get Them

Here is a look at each of the animals you can obtain for your ranch, alongside which NPCs you need to gain trust with and where to find them. You will normally find each of the Ranch Managers at their ranch during the day, while they often head to the Inn at night.
Once you have reached 100 Trust with the respective NPC, you will be able to "buy" the Ranch animals from Ben at your Camp (Ranch Manager) not from the NPCs themselves. You only need to go to the NPCs to get the Trust to 100.
1. Chicks/Chickens

The first animal we'll unlock are chicks. Just talk to Ben, and you can buy your first little army of them.
- NPC: Ben (Your Ranch Manager).
- Requirement: Unlock the Ranch.
- Reward: You can purchase a few Chicks for your ranch
- Resources: Eggs - Feathers
- Butchered: Feathers - Small Bone - Lean Bird Meat
2. Pigs: Start at Home
One of the easiest unlocks is pigs. You don't even have to leave Howling Hill to start this process.
- NPC: Ben (Your Ranch Manager)
- Requirement: Reach 100 Trust with Ben.
- Reward: You can purchase Baby Pigs directly from his shop menu at the ranch
- Resources: N/A
- Butchered: Small Bone - Thin Hide - Marbled Meat
3. Cows: The Broken Rancher


To get cattle without the hassle of a long-distance cattle drive, you need to help a man who has lost his own herd.
- NPC: Bremer
- Location: Usually found at Muckroot Ranch (near Hernand Town, see image)
- Finding Him: If he’s not at the ranch, check the Inn at Hernand in the evenings; he’s often at a table to the right of the door. By Chapter 5, players have reported him sitting in the Hernand Town Square near the notice board
- Requirement: Reach 100 Trust with Bremer
- Reward: Unlocks Cows for purchase at Ben’s shop
- Resources: Milk - Short Horn
- Butchered: Large Bone - Short Hair Hide - Tender Meat - Short Horn
4. Sheep: The Search for Wooly


Sheep are unlocked by befriending the child associated with the "Wooly" questline.
- NPC: Willian
- Location: Bloomwood Ranch (see image)
- Finding Him: Willian is a wanderer, often found in the sheep pens or talking to goats. Like Bremer, he may appear in the Hernand Town Square during Chapter 5. It also seems like you need to complete the "Wooly" quest first. This quest is one of the four starter bulletin board quests.
- Requirement: Reach 100 Trust with Willian (use gifts like Coin Purses to speed this up)
- Reward: Unlocks Sheep/Lambs for purchase at Ben’s shop
- Resources: Fleece
- Butchered: Small Bone - Short Hair Hide - Fine Meat - Short Horn - Fleece
5. Goats: The Mountain Pastures


If you’re looking for goats, you’ll need to head southwest to the rocky terrain near Bluemont.
- NPC: Ibano
- Location: Capra Pasture (Directly southwest of Bluemont Manor, see image)
- Requirement: Reach 100 Trust with Ibano
- Reward: Unlocks Goats for purchase at Ben’s shop
- Resources: Milk - Short Horn
- Butchered: Small Bone - Short Hair Hide - Fine Meat - Short Horn

Tips for Fast Tracking Your Ranch
- The Gift of Gab (and Gold): The fastest way to "Max Trust" is by gifting. Keep hold of any Coin Purses specifically to dump on these NPCs.
- Check the Map Symbols: Look for the Livestock Symbol on your map. While not every NPC at these locations unlocks an animal, the "Ranch Owners" are almost always the key.
- Manual Entry: If you are short on silver, you can technically steal or find dairy cows and bulls in the wild and ride them back. However, ensure they are "Dairy" variants, or the ranch may not register them.
- Chapter 5 Consolidation: If you are struggling to find Willian or Bremer, progress to Chapter 5. Many NPCs congregate in Hernand during this part of the story, making it a "one-stop shop" for maxing out friendships.
